This office has calculated uplift pressures for the above referenced project in accordance with
ASCE 7-10 in order to assist in the specification of an appropriate roof waterproofing system. All
building dimensions, characteristics, and geographical information are as follows: 1- story
residential building 13' x 21" aprox. roof area. 12' high, mean roof ht., flat roof pitch, 170 mph
wind zone, over 1 mile from the ocean, exposure C and an enclosed building.

The calculated fastener enhancement for the above referenced project in accordance with
Roofing Application Standard (RAS) 117 to assist in the specification of a roof system.
EXISTING WOOD DECK TO BE RENAILED
The existing 19/32" min plywood deck @24" supports shall be nailed using 8 d ring
shank nails.
Panel edges in Zone #1 @6" oc and Zone #2 @6" oc and Zone 3 overhang @4" oc.
BASED ON NOA
FIELD: SHALL BE NAILED @ 9"OC @ LAP, 2 STAGGERED ROWS, 9" OC IN
ZONE 1
PERIMETER: SHALL BE NAILED @ 4"OC @ LAP, 2 STAGGERED ROWS, 4" OC IN
ZONE 2
CORNER: SHALL BE NAILED @ 4" OC @ LAP, 4 STAGGERED ROWS, 4" OC IN
ZONES 3
The dimension of the perimeter and corner areas can be calculated as follows:
Perimeter:
Use the lesser of .4 times the building height or .1 times the buildings lesser planned dimension
and never less than 4% the lesser planned dimension or 3 feet.
